saddle discoloration
I just got a red flite gel flow a week ago (great b-day present!)
I looked at it this morning before I went on a ride and I noticed that there was some discoloration just behind the nose on the right side
I have only ridden it 200 miles, have only washed it with soap and water (no degreasers or solvents), and have only used non-petroleum based chamois creams
Any body else have this problem? I tried the search function, but came up empty.
(I did email selle italia with the problem and pics and am waiting for a reply)

Its water damage, don't wash it, when I rode a lot in the rain, my Selle italia SLR Kit Carbonio started to lose its black colour on the spots that experienced the most wear, the water accelerates this.
